6th Grade Earth Science
6th Grade Earth Science builds on students’ natural curiosity about the world around them. By exploring geological history, fascinating landforms, the oceans and atmosphere, and recent discoveries about the universe, the course helps students connect science to their everyday lives.
Students investigate topics such as geology, oceanography, meteorology, and astronomy, including Earth’s minerals and rocks, Earth’s interior, plate tectonics, earthquakes, volcanoes, continental movement, the fossil record, oceans and atmosphere, and the solar system. Lesson activities encourage students to discover how scientists study and understand our planet.
